It all started with a casual conversation at “Coffee with a Cop” last year at Starbucks. John Hamlin, of Hamlin & Associates, and Volusia County Chair Ed Kelley met with Ormond Beach police officers and command staff and said that they wanted to show support for their local law enforcement agency.
A few days later, Hamlin donated the funds to obtain 10Alpha-1, a robot costume, to participate in community events and the funds to wrap the OBPD Crime Prevention vehicle in stars and stripes and a new wrap for the D.A.R.E. vehicle. Brian Kelley, of Florida Georgia Line, donated the funds to obtain new police protective shields to keep the officers safe in potentially dangerous situations.
Hamlin and the Kelley family met with officers at the police station March 27, and Chief Jesse Godfrey and members of his staff showed their appreciation and gratitude.
“We are extremely grateful for these generous donations that will keep the men and women of this department safe and connected to our community,” said Godfrey in a press release.
